This week, it’s my turn for the assignment:

As I’m sure most of you know, John Prine is hanging on by a thread right now. This week, in John’s honor, I want you all to spend an hour with John’s music. Read up on him, too, if you’re not as familiar as you ought to be. Read his Wiki entry, read some lyric sheets, and if you’re so inclined, read Eddie Huffman’s excellent bio, “John Prine: In Spite Of Himself.” There’s no requirement for your writing this week to reflect a Prine influence, but you’re encouraged to see if you can learn something and apply it.

Also, don’t forget that starting this week, you’ll be required to critique one song from the previous round.
